Abstract

1. 1. Insulin receptors were investigated in isolated chromaffin cells from bovine adrenal medulla. 2. 2. The cells were incubated with [ 125I]insulin in HEPES buffer, pH 7.8 at 15°C for 180 min to obtain steady state binding. Specific binding was linearly related to the number of cells in the range 0.5–10 × 10 6 cells/ml. Insulin and proinsulin caused half maximal displacement of specifically bound tracer in concentrations of 0.18 and 2.46 nM, respectively. 3. 3. Computer analysis of the binding data gave a linear Scatchard plot, consistent with a single class of non-interacting receptors with an affinity constant of 5.6 nM −1, the total number of receptors per cell being 1700. 4. 4. The apparent MW of the insulin binding subunit of the receptor was 135,000, determined by affinity crosslinking and SDS gel electrophoresis under reducing conditions.
